How to Safely Use a Cordless Snow Blower on Ice — and When to Upgrade

Operating a snow blower on icy ground can be risky — not just for your equipment, but also for your safety. While cordless snow blowers are light and easy to use, they require extra care on slippery surfaces. If your area experiences frequent freezing rain or icy buildup, it’s important to know how to use your cordless model safely — and when it might be time to switch to something more powerful.

Tips for Using Cordless Snow Blowers on Icy Surfaces

Even though cordless snow blowers aren’t designed for deep ice, the following techniques can help you get better results and stay safe:

Clear loose snow first. Removing the softer top layer allows the auger to make contact with the ice below more effectively.

Work slowly and steadily. Avoid forcing the auger into frozen sections; instead, chip away gradually.

Improve your traction. Wear anti-slip boots or cleats to prevent falls on icy ground.

Keep batteries warm. Store batteries indoors before use to maintain power and runtime.

Avoid overloading the motor. If the auger stops spinning, pause immediately to prevent damage.

These small adjustments can make a big difference in both safety and performance.

Limitations You’ll Notice Over Time

If you live in a region with frequent freeze–thaw cycles, you’ll eventually hit the limits of your cordless snow blower.

Reduced torque: The auger struggles to break through hard, icy layers.

Shorter runtime: Batteries drain faster in extreme cold.

Inefficient scraping: Lightweight blades can’t reach the pavement through ice.

At this point, upgrading to a more robust solution becomes the logical next step.
